iStockphoto offering 700,000 images to HP customers

The recently acquired micro-payment stock photography site iStockphoto has announced that it has signed a new deal with Hewlett Packard (HP) to offer more than 700,000 image to HP customers starting at just $1 each, via the HP In-House Marketing Portal, an online resource that provides small and medium businesses (SMBs) with tools to create marketing materials internally. “iStockphoto provides outstanding imagery for a great price,” said Vince Ferraro, vice president of marketing, LaserJet Business, HP. “By using iStockphoto’s extensive online image library combined with HP’s industry-leading color printers, small businesses can now develop professional-quality marketing and presentation materials at a fraction of the traditional time and cost.” One has to think that deals like this are exactly what Getty Images had in mind when it acquired iStockphoto.
